      <content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="float_right" src="/~~/f?id=490795d5796c7a7a00270e18&maxX=336&maxY=220" border="0" alt="pinkslip.jpg" title="pinkslip.jpg" width="336" height="220" />Admit it, CEOs: Layoffs are coming to your company. And while getting through that is going to suck, know what is going to be worse? The lawsuits.</p>
<p>Fortunately, we talked to HR lawyer Kirk Nemer of <a href="http://careerprotection.com/employmentnegotiation.html">Career Protection</a> and he told us how to pull off cutting your workforce without getting sued:</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Bone up on employment laws. </strong>It's a good idea to ask laid-off employees to sign a waiver or release promising not to sue, but be careful giving them deadlines. The OWBPA Act stipulates that if an employee is over 40, they get a minimum of 21 days to consider signing the release and another 7 days to change their mind after they do. If a company cuts a group of employees, each employee gets 45 days to consider the release. Force them to sign any sooner, and the waiver's no good. <em>A reminder:</em> In California there's the WARN Act, which requires companies laying off more than 50 employees to give them 60 days notice. <br /><br /></li>
<li><strong>Pay out severance according to title and length of service. Only</strong>. Don't play favorites. Be objective and use length of service and title as your guide. One of Nemer's clients was a director, but his company only prepared severance packages for vice presidents and regional managers. When the company canned Nemer's guy, it gave him a regional manager's severance because it was cheaper. Now he's suing.<br /><br /></li>
<li><strong>Don't treat laid off employees like criminals. </strong>Laid-off employees do not all need to be escorted from the building by burly, armed guards before 3 p.m. or else. That kind of confrontational stance "sets up a battle," says Nemer -- a legal battle.<br /><br /></li>
<li><strong>Don't set layoff traps. </strong>Nemer tells us that one easy way to drive laid-off employees to their lawyers is to lie to them. One of his clients who'd been with her company 14 years got a note one day from her supervisor asking her to attend a new project meeting. When she did, she found the meeting room vacant but for her boss and an HR rep. They canned her on the spot and then security escorted her out of the building as a part of a general layoff. Now she's one of Nemer's clients, suing her old employer just months after getting a standing ovation during an all hands meeting.<br /><br /></li>
<li> <strong>Be clear to blame the economy, not the employee. </strong>Admit that the company has hit hard times and that the layoff has nothing to do with the employee's performance. Do not lie or make excuses. Laying off one of Nemer's clients, one company HR rep asked for her resignation. She refused and asked what she'd done wrong. "Nothing" said the rep, who then admitted Nemer's client was part of a general layoff. Another of Nemer's client's only joined a company after months of recruiting. Then, just yet a few more months later, they told him the company didn't have a role for him anymore.  "You recruited me for this role!" Nemer's client told the CEO. Lies, damned lies. They'll get your name at the top of a double-spaced PDF.</li>

      <content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="float_right" src="/~~/f?id=4831918e14b9b90a00fa2cbf&maxX=220&maxY=104" border="0" alt="akamai.jpg" title="akamai.jpg" width="220" height="104" />No surprise: More cuts in the media/tech business. Content delivery network Akamai Technologies (AKAM) will lay off 110 employees, or about 7% of its workforce, the company said today in a <a href="http://biz.yahoo.com/e/081119/akam8-k.html">filing to the SEC</a>.</p>
<p>Industry watcher Dan Rayburn <a href="http://blog.streamingmedia.com/the_business_of_online_vi/2008/11/akamai-to-layoff-110-employees-10-of-workforce.html">says the cuts</a> are across the company's various divisions. Akamai is still hiring for some positions in its new advertising service group, according to Rayburn.</p>
<p>Akamai detailed the charges it'll incur:</p>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;">As a result of these cost-cutting measures, the Company expects to incur aggregate restructuring charges and other costs of approximately $4.0 million in the fourth quarter of 2008. These anticipated charges consist of approximately $3.8 million for severance and similar personnel-related expenses and approximately $0.2 million in other costs. These costs are expected to be partially offset by a net reduction in non-cash stock-based compensation of $0.8 million, reflecting a modification to certain stock-based awards previously granted to the affected employees. Additionally, the Company expects to recognize a loss on sublease income of approximately $2.5 million related to certain leased facilities. The Company expects to incur total cash expenditures of approximately $6.0 million in connection with these cost-reduction measures.</p>

      <content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="float_right" src="/~~/f?id=47d7f2ef14b9b9b00066be82&maxX=223&maxY=85" border="0" alt="tivo-box.jpg" title="tivo-box.jpg" width="223" height="85" />DVR maker TiVo (TIVO) is shedding staff, the company reveals in a <a href="http://sec.gov/Archives/edgar/data/1088825/000119312508238568/d8k.htm">SEC filing</a>:</p>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;">On November 18, 2008, we commenced a plan to reduce our operational expenses, primarily through a reduction in headcount, as we manage through the challenges presented by a difficult economic climate and a rapidly evolving retail consumer market.</p>
<p>We're interpreting "a rapidly evolving consumer market" to mean the company is getting clobbered by cheap alternative DVR solutions built into cable and satellite set-top boxes.</p>
<p>We called Tivo to ask how many layoffs are in the works and haven't heard back yet. But it's probably not too many: The company says in its filing it will take a pre-tax charge of just $1 million for severance benefits and out-placement.</p>
<p>TiVo reports Q3 results next Tuesday. We suppose they'll outline some of their cuts then.</p>

      <content:encoded><![CDATA[<p align="justify"><a href="http://startupmeme.com/dell-to-employees-bon-voyage-or-else/"><img style="0px" align="left" src="http://i.dell.com/images/emea/logos/dell_logo_new_emea.jpg" width="200" height="204" title="DELL to Employees &ndash; Bon Voyage or Else" alt="dell_logo_new_emea DELL to Employees &ndash; Bon Voyage or Else" /></a>Dell has threatened almost all of it’s employees that it will begin Axing down employees if they don&#8217;t agree with the companies policy of taking a week off without pay(unpaid leave).</p>
<p align="justify">
<p align="justify">
<p align="justify">Employees got a memo today from CEO Michael Dell, stating to cut the companies costs and increase profit this quarter.</p>
<p align="justify">Part of Dell&#8217;s scheme asks workers to take up to five days off without pay sometime within the next three months. The company also instituted a global hiring freeze, is offering voluntary severance packages, cutting travel budgets, and sacking temporary and contract employees.</p>
<blockquote><p align="justify">We&#8217;re taking action in this fourth quarter to reduce costs and improve Dell&#8217;s long term competitiveness in a time of economic uncertainty, said Dell spokesman David Frink.</p>
</blockquote>
<p align="justify">It’s a common pattern now that even technology companies along with financial institutions are slaying of it’ most important assets(Human Resource) like anything. Of course, just like PC market share, Dell plays second fiddle to Hewlett-Packard in mass sacking. HP announced in September it would lay off 24,600 jobs worldwide as it merges the massive IT services organization EDS with its own existing massive IT service organization.</p>

      <content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="float_right" src="/~~/f?id=4901f4a7796c7a3d006ca5f4&maxX=340&maxY=255" border="0" alt="YahooNewYork.jpg" title="YahooNewYork.jpg" width="340" height="255" />While they wait for <a href="http://www.alleyinsider.com/2008/10/jerry-s-promise-to-yahoos-i-ll-fire-you-before-thanksgiving">more details from Jerry</a>, former and current Yahoos can only speculate as to what the upcoming layoffs will look like. One former Yahoo shared a plausible theory regarding the New York offices Yahoo added when it acquired Right Media in 2007:</p>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;">NY is going to get hit pretty hard with the layoffs and then they are going to close the old Right Media office since that is very expensive real estate and the office is basically empty. Something like 75% of the people who worked for right media pre-acquisition have left the company (at least on the tech side. I don't know anyone on business).</p>
<p>This is obviously just speculation at this point. But it's plausible:</p>
<ul>
<li>If our source is correct about all the departures, there's no point in paying rent on an office that's half empty.<br /></li>
<li>Including the Right Media location on 2 Park Avenue, Yahoo currently has 3 offices in New York -- (the others are a HotJobs office on 18th Street) and a sales office in midtown. That's about two offices too many.</li>
<li>Former Right Media CEO Mike Walrath has already vacated his space in the old office, after moving to the Bay Area this fall.</li>
<li><a href="http://valleywag.com/389293/yahoo/">The old Right Media office is ugly</a>.</li>
</ul>
